The Netherlands ranked as a great place to work, but not necessarily to live

In the latest Expat Insider Survey, the Netherlands achieved an overall ranking of 33rd out of 59 countries, performing particularly well when it comes to career prospects and work-life balance, but proving to be exceptionally unwelcoming and expensive. InterNations Expat Insider 2021 Survey Published by InterNations – a network of expats around the world – […]

Continue Reading